Hydroxymethylglutaryl-CoA Synthase, Cytoplasmic
**Semantic type:** Amino Acid, Peptide, or Protein|Enzyme
**Definition:** Hydroxymethylglutaryl-CoA synthase, cytoplasmic (520 aa, ~57 kDa) is encoded by the human HMGCS1 gene. This protein plays a role in the condensation of acetyl-Coenzyme A with acetoacetyl-CoA to form hydroxymethylglutaryl-CoA (HMG-CoA).
**Synonyms:** - 3-Hydroxy-3-Methylglutaryl Coenzyme A Synthase - 3-Hydroxy-3-Methylglutaryl-Co A Synthase 1 - EC 2.3.3.10 - HMG-CoA Synthase - HMG-CoA Synthase 1 - HMGCS1
